Volvo FL named Fleet Vehicle of the Year

May 6, 2009

The Fleet Management Institute in Poland and Polish trade magazine Flota have named the Volvo FL the 2009 Fleet Vehicle of the Year in the Fleet Awards Polska Trucks category.

The Fleet Awards Polska recognizes the top fleet vehicles on the market, based on opinions of fleet managers. Nominated vehicles are available for testing and votes are submitted online over a three-month period.

It is the third Fleet Vehicle of the Year award for Volvo Trucks and the second consecutive year the FL has won. In 2007, the Volvo FH was victorious.

"We are very pleased that our Volvo FL series received the Fleet Vehicle of the Year award," said Pontus Stenberg, gm of Volvo Truck Center, Poland. "It proves that the Volvo Trucks offer is very strong in the segment of trucks for lighter applications as well, such as local and regional distribution."

The FL comes in the 12-18 ton range and because of its easy maneuverability, Volvo said it’s perfect for operation on congested city streets. The engine is an in-line, 6-cylinder diesel with 7.2 liters of displacement pumping out between 240 and 290 hp, depending on the engine spec’d. It includes an electronically controlled fuel injection with common rail technology. Choices include a 6-sp. or 9-sp. manual gearbox, an automatic transmission or I-Sync, which Volvo said combined the benefits of a manual gearbox with the convenience of an automatic transmission.
